Depending on the amount of drinking/cooking water that you use, you might consider a reverse osmosis unit. I'm on a well with high iron, hardness and ph. Even after treating, the taste is so-so. I put in an RO unit to feed up to kitchen sink. I installed it so cost was less than $200. Replace the sediment filters every 3-4 months and the charcoal filter every 6-8. Use cheap filters from Menards. Water tastes the same as bottled water.
